The Opportunity


Stewart McKelvey’s Chief Operating Officer (COO) will be responsible for overseeing all non-legal shared services functions including administrative operations, risk and compliance, IT operations, marketing, communications, and events. This will require championing innovation and change to ensure that our systems, technology and workflows efficiently facilitate the core, client-facing legal operations of this growing firm.


In strategic alignment with the executive team and partnership board, this role will design, implement and regularly adapt systems and processes to increase efficiency and resiliency within the firm, and prepare us to lead an innovative practice of tomorrow. The role of the COO is to be proactive in managing quality and ensuring strategic review and continuous improvement, while developing and mentoring a strong team.
